Handover: Marek → Ilsa. Cursor pagination on the Fenwick Routes API is live. Opaque cursors are HMAC-signed; limit capped at 200. Offset params are rejected, not ignored — check the 400 handler before review. Cursor expiry is 15 minutes. Audit log of cursor forgeries is in the Larkspan vault, which needs the recovery passphrase below.

vault phrase of taweg-kafof = oliax-zorael

**Ticket: Quota drift between regions**

Welcome to the fun part of Tarnwick onboarding! We've noticed the per-tenant rate quotas in the east cluster no longer match what's in the Plumstone config repo — someone hot-patched values during the Fennwick incident and never committed them. New folks: always change quotas through the repo, never directly on the nodes, or we end up with exactly this. To help with the cleanup, I've pulled the values currently live on the east cluster, shown below.

service settings:
[casax]
port = 6379
team = rusir
host = casax.zemvarhq.corp
region = outer-4
access_code = ac_9808ce
timeout_ms = 1500

Ticket: config drift during cron-to-workflow migration — Orbweft platform. For context (especially newer folks): we are moving the remaining cron jobs on the Saltmere hosts into the Loomline workflow engine. During the transition, several jobs were defined in both places with slightly different schedules and retry settings, which caused duplicate runs of the billing rollup on two nights. The cron definitions are now frozen; Loomline is the single source of truth. Its scheduler must run with the following configuration values.

config for kafof-bawef:
holath:
  log_level: debug
  metrics_host: metrics.holath.qorvelsys.internal
  pin: 2191
  pool_size: 32